7LineFan 256 Posted August 14, 2008 Share #2 Posted August 14, 2008 Supposedly it doesn't take place in NY anymore. From wiki. "The film's original director, Patrick Tatopoulos, originally planned to shoot the film in 2005 in New York City and Montreal. Tatopoulos left the production in 2006 and was replaced by Ryuhei Kitamura. The story's setting was changed from New York City, due to the prohibitive cost of shooting there. Various locations in Los Angeles, including the L.A. Metro subway system, were used instead."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
